Live Sports Streaming With Prioritized Media-Over-QUIC Transport

Zafer Gurel, Tugce Erkilic Civelek, Ali C. Begen, Alex Giladi

A QUIC-based low-latency delivery solution for media ingest and distribution in browser and non-browser environments is currently being developed for various use cases such as live streaming, cloud gaming, remote desktop, videoconferencing, and eSports. Operating in an Hyptertext Transfer Protocaol (HTTP)/3 environment (i.e., using WebTransport in browsers) or using raw (Quick UDP Internet Connection) QUIC transport, QUIC can revolutionize the media industry, overcoming the limitations we face with the traditional approaches that impose TCP. This study explains the design methodology and explores possible gains with QUIC's stream prioritization features.
